A Trailblazing Career in Media

Laura Ingraham, a leading voice at Fox News, has built an impressive career. Born in 1963 to a working-class family, she graduated in 1981 and pursued higher education at Dartmouth College. There, she made history as the first female editor of The Dartmouth Review. Despite facing controversies and a libel lawsuit during her tenure, she stood her ground and set the stage for her future in media.

Stepping Into Politics and Law

After college, Ingraham worked as a speechwriter in the Reagan administration. She later earned her Juris Doctor degree and clerked for prominent federal judges. Her media journey began in the mid-1990s, hosting MSNBC’s Watch It! and eventually launching The Laura Ingraham Show. In 2017, she became the host of Fox News’ The Ingraham Angle, solidifying her place in conservative commentary.

Personal Relationships: Highs and Challenges

Ingraham’s personal life has drawn significant public interest. She dated political commentator Dinesh D’Souza during her Dartmouth years. Later, in 2005, she became engaged to businessman James V. Reyes. However, her breast cancer diagnosis shortly after the engagement led to the difficult decision to call off the wedding.

She also had relationships with broadcaster Keith Olbermann in 1998 and was rumored to have dated former Senator Robert Torricelli in 1999. Despite these high-profile connections, she has never married.

Building a Family Through Adoption

Ingraham has embraced motherhood through adoption. She adopted her daughter, Maria, from Guatemala in 2008 and later welcomed two sons, Dmitri and Nikolai, from Russia in 2009 and 2011. As a single mother, she balances her thriving career with her commitment to raising her children in Washington, D.C.
